分布式定时任务调度框架实践

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

分布式定时任务调度框架实践嘿,今天我们聊聊分布式定时任务调度框架。

这听起来是不是有点高大上?但说白了就是如何让一堆任务在合适的时间点上乖乖地执行,像是一场完美的音乐会,所有乐器都在合适的节奏里和谐共鸣。

想象一下,你的手机响了,提醒你喝水、吃饭,甚至别忘了上班。

这些小任务就像是生活中的小精灵,轻轻在你耳边叮咛,让你不至于在忙碌中迷失方向。

分布式定时任务调度框架就像是一个聪明的管家,负责管理这些小精灵的工作。

它把所有的任务分散到不同的地方,不再把所有的鸡蛋放在一个篮子里。

这样一来,就算某个篮子摔了,其他的也能继续运作,真是聪明得很。

比如说,你有一个网站,用户量大得吓人,订单多得数不过来。

你可不能一个个手动去处理吧?这时候,调度框架就出场了,自动把这些订单处理任务分配给不同的服务器,每个服务器都忙得不亦乐乎,整个过程就像是一场流畅的接力赛。

管理这些任务的调度框架也有很多种选择。

有的像是个老江湖,经过多年的锤炼,稳定得让人放心;有的则像是新兴的年轻人,充满了活力和创意。

这些框架各有千秋,使用起来也各自有自己的小套路。

比如,Quartz 就是个响当当的角色,它支持复杂的
调度规则,甚至可以精确到秒。

这就像你想给自己设个定时器,提醒你每隔一小时站起来走一走,呵,别让久坐的办公生活把你折磨得像个榴莲。

说到这里,调度框架还有一个很重要的特点,就是容错性。

万一哪台服务器掉链子,没关系,调度框架会立马将任务转移到其他健康的服务器上,确保一切照常进行。

简直就像在打牌,虽然偶尔会有人掉线,但大家还是能继续玩得热火朝天,绝不耽误兴致。

在搭建这个调度框架的时候,有几点是需要特别注意的。

你得考虑任务的优先级。

有些任务紧急得像火烧眉毛,得立马处理;而有些则可以慢慢来,等有空再说。

这个时候,调度框架就像一个机灵的裁判,聪明地安排好每个任务的上场时间,让一切有条不紊。

还有哦,得确保每个任务都能在合理的时间内完成。

谁想在过了饭点还在忙活呢?这可不是个好主意。

监控也是不可忽视的一环。

想象一下,你的调度框架就像一个聪明的小监视器,时刻盯着每个任务的执行情况。

如果某个任务出问题了,它会立马发出警报,告诉你:“嘿,有点不对劲,快来看看!”这样一来,你就能及时处理问题,不至于让小问题演变成大麻烦,真是事半功倍。

分布式定时任务调度框架就像是生活中的好帮手,默默地为我们分担压力。

它的存在让我们的工作和生活都更加高效、顺畅。

这就像在繁忙的生活中找到了一个懂你心思的好朋友,轻轻松松就把事情处理妥当。

未来,随着技术的不断发展,调度框架会变得更加智能、灵活,谁知道呢,也许有一天它能帮你安排约会、计划旅行,甚至还能提醒你什么时候该休息、什么时候该放松。

想想都觉得兴奋,期待未来的每一天!。

相关文档
最新文档